Abstract

944,165. Ammunition fuzes. GEB. JUNGHANS A.G. Feb. 17, 1960 [Feb. 17, 1959], No. 9185/63. Divided out of 944,164. Heading F3A. A percussion fuze for unrotated projectiles in which an inertia sleeve 114 is coupled with a thrust sleeve 115 which arms a rocker plate 141 of the primer carrier is made safe against premature arming by a lever 134 having a rear arm bearing against the sleeve 115 and a front arm 137 bearing against the sleeve 114 when in the safety position, sleeve 114 having a milled flat 138 against which arm 137 can bear when the lever 134 is rocked by the rear end of sleeve 114. Also the sleeve 115 is provided with a groove 138b into which the rear arm 136 of the lever can swing. As in Specification 944,164 a finger 123 extends rearwardly from the sleeve 115 to immobilize the plate 141 and an escapement pallet 125 until positive acceleration of the projectile has ended. When the projectile fitted with the fuze is fired, an inertia pin 120, on which is an adjustable weight 121, sets back against its spring 122 and before reaching its rearmost position rocks a safety lever 129, Fig. 2, thus releasing the inertia sleeve 114. Sleeve 114 then slides into sleeve 115, and a spring 119 moving into the groove 118 of sleeve 114 couples the two sleeves together. When acceleration ceases a spring 116 moves the two sleeves forwardly withdrawing the finger 123 from the plate 141 and the escapement pallet 125. A torsion spring 145 then swings the primer 146 to the armed position in line with the striker 113, so that if impact occurs the striker pin is driven against the primer. If the fuze is dropped on its nose during transport, the pin 120 and the sleeve 114 remain in the safe position. The sleeve 115 could move forwardly and so withdraw the safety finger 123, but for the presence of lever 134 of which arm 136 extends into the path of sleeve 115, the lever 134 only being rocked aside by rearward movement of sleeve 114.
